JP, you are a lawyer too, you know a delay BY A JUDGE in making a decision can mean anything [img]/images/graemlins/wink.gif[/img] .

But the likely problem is that the shotgun approach of the iMega suit means the judge has to make multiple rulings, not all involving the same law or arguments.

I believe a fair bit of the iMega suit will survive the standing/ripeness challenge, but not all of it. I a pretty sure all parts that concern the still unadopted regulations will go, and the judge will probably exclude other areas that dont directly affect affiliates, the only specific persons (as far as I know) iMega has identified in their "group" of plaintiffs. But it is hard to say for sure at this early stage of the litigation.
